Feeling exhausted all day but wide awake at night is incredibly common after 30.

This is often not a sleep problem.
It is a nervous system problem.

When stress, under-eating, caffeine, and mental overload stack up, your body stays in alert mode.

That is why your mind races the moment your head hits the pillow.
Start with simple changes.
Eat enough protein during the day.
Stop caffeine earlier.

Create a 20-minute wind-down routine before bed.
Better sleep starts long before bedtime.
